Message type: E = Error
Message class: /IAM/CONFIG -
Message number: 192
Message text: Status profile '&1' cannot be assigned to issue type '&2'

The SAP error message /IAM/CONFIG192 indicates that there is an issue with assigning a status profile to a specific issue type in the Identity Access Management (IAM) module. This error typically arises when the configuration settings for status profiles and issue types are not aligned or properly set up.
Cause: Missing Status Profile: The status profile you are trying to assign may not exist or may not be properly configured in the system. Incorrect Issue Type: The issue type you are trying to assign the status profile to may not be compatible with that profile. Authorization Issues: There may be authorization restrictions preventing the assignment of the status profile to the issue type. Configuration Errors: There could be errors in the configuration settings related to status profiles or issue types in the IAM module.
